2017-11-02 8 views
0

私はPyCharmとWindowsで開発されたプロジェクトを持っています。プロジェクトは、Pythonベースであり、正常に動作します。 pyCharmエディタを使ったプロジェクトはうまくコンパイルされ、期待どおりに動作します。しかし、Sublime/MacOSでプロジェクトをビルドしようとすると、モジュールをインポートできないというエラーが発生します。pycharm対sublime、WindowsOS対MacOS

インスタンスの場合、添付のスクリーンショットにconfigフォルダが表示されますが、FrameworkConfigと他のスクリプトがあります。 Driver.pyから呼び出されると、MacOSやLinuxで "import error"がスローされます。しかし、Windowsでは正常に動作します。私は何が欠けていますか?私はホームディレクトリを適切に設定し、適切に指摘されていることに注意してください。

enter image description here

+0

偶然python2.7を使用している可能性はありますか? 'python3 .py'で実行していることを確認してください。 –

+0

はい私はpyton2.7です。これを実行する方法はありますか? – lpt

答えて

1

あなたのPYTHONPATHとあなたのsys.pathを見てみましょう、PyCharmは、それらのいくつかに、プロジェクトのパスを追加するために使用します(わからないその1)自動的に、ので、多分それはあなたがSublimeTextを使用して、それを実行することはできません理由です。私もそこにいました。

関連する問題